新华全媒+ | 2260公里跨越5省份 0.007秒“疆电”点亮山城
Xin Hua She· 2025-06-10 08:26
Core Points - The "Xinjiang Power to Chongqing" project is China's first ultra-high voltage direct current transmission line connecting the northwest and southwest regions, enabling efficient electricity transfer over a distance of 2260 kilometers [1][3] - The project has a total investment of approximately 28.6 billion yuan and is expected to deliver over 36 billion kilowatt-hours of electricity annually, with more than half coming from renewable sources [1][3] - The project is part of a broader strategy to enhance energy resource allocation in China, particularly addressing the energy supply and carbon reduction pressures faced by eastern and central provinces [3][4] Investment and Economic Impact - The project is expected to significantly lower electricity costs for data centers in Chongqing, which have a growing demand for green electricity [2] - The renewable energy capacity associated with the project includes 10.2 million kilowatts from wind, solar, and thermal sources, accounting for over 70% of the total installed capacity [1][3] - The project will help reduce coal consumption by approximately 6 million tons and decrease carbon dioxide emissions by about 16 million tons annually [1] Technological Advancements - The core equipment at the converter stations has been domestically produced, enhancing the stability and efficiency of renewable energy transmission [2] - The converter stations utilize advanced technology, including second-generation synchronous condensers, which have world-leading performance in key parameters [2] - The project includes customized designs for transmission towers to withstand high wind speeds, ensuring structural integrity and reliability [3] Renewable Energy Potential - Xinjiang has significant renewable energy resources, with a technical potential of 780 million kilowatts for wind energy and 1.6 trillion kilowatt-hours for solar energy [3] - The project exemplifies the potential for Xinjiang to become a national energy resource hub, addressing the mismatch between energy production and consumption in different regions [3][4] - The time difference between Xinjiang and central/eastern regions allows for effective utilization of solar energy, supporting national energy supply during peak demand periods [4]
“疆电入渝”工程正式投产送电 “沙戈荒”绿电7毫秒到重庆
Yang Shi Wang· 2025-06-10 04:01
Core Viewpoint - The "Jiangdian into Chongqing" project, part of China's "14th Five-Year Plan," has successfully commenced power transmission, utilizing over 70% renewable energy from a 14.2 million kilowatt power source [1][6]. Group 1: Project Overview - The "Jiangdian into Chongqing" project connects five provinces and municipalities, spanning 2,260 kilometers, and has achieved operational status in under two years, setting a record for the fastest construction of a high-voltage transmission line over 2,000 kilometers in China [2][4]. - The project leverages unique wind and solar resources in the arid regions of Xinjiang, with the local area currently utilizing less than 5% of its renewable energy potential [6][15]. Group 2: Technical Challenges and Solutions - The construction faced significant challenges due to complex terrains, including snow-capped mountains and deserts, with winter temperatures in Xinjiang dropping to -30 degrees Celsius [5]. - To ensure stability in high-wind areas, the construction team reinforced transmission towers in regions with wind speeds reaching level 10, enhancing the safety of the power lines [5]. Group 3: Environmental Impact - The project is expected to deliver 36 billion kilowatt-hours of electricity annually to Chongqing, with a clean energy ratio of at least 50%, resulting in a reduction of 16.5 million tons of CO2 emissions each year, equivalent to planting 900 million trees [7][15]. Group 4: Technological Aspects - The project employs a ±800 kV high-voltage direct current (HVDC) system, allowing electricity to travel from Xinjiang to Chongqing in just 7 milliseconds, significantly improving the cross-regional consumption of clean energy [8][10]. - The Chongqing converter station, covering 27 hectares, utilizes advanced technology for monitoring and maintaining the core components, ensuring efficient conversion from direct current to alternating current for household use [12][14]. Group 5: Economic Significance - The "Jiangdian into Chongqing" project enhances the energy structure of Chongqing, providing enough electricity for 10 million households annually, and supports the economic development of both Xinjiang and Chongqing [15].
